Output 66b97526f0ff245f0ddcfdc205fa19aa8fc0becbcd4465cec6e265e4e057dd62:1

value
87800567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4622724de83bc43c8f57ce4e3ba361c698ce6f72 OP_EQUAL
address
385rVMeMuNVmPDXaNwy5qjtWNs7StMdMtm
transaction
66b97526f0ff245f0ddcfdc205fa19aa8fc0becbcd4465cec6e265e4e057dd62
confirmations
346723
spent
false